You should get a shop that has experience in electrical installs. NOT your local service garage or even a stereo install place. Go to someone who will not just chop into the harness, but get the right plugs, etc. and do it right. I have talked to people who have had the car catch on fire because of bad electrical installs!!!

As someone who has a background in electronics and who has rewired entire cars, I tell you this!
